What Each Part Means

Bank Code — HUSB
The first 4 characters uniquely identify Hutatma Sahakari Bank at the national level. Every branch of Hutatma Sahakari Bank across all states shares this same prefix. It is assigned by the RBI and never changes.
Reserved — 0
The 5th character is always 0 (zero), reserved by the RBI for future use. It acts as a separator between the bank identifier and the branch-specific code and is mandatory in all electronic fund transfer systems.
Branch Code — 000003
The final 6 characters 000003 uniquely identify this specific branch within the Hutatma Sahakari Bank network. No two branches share the same branch code. Use this code to verify you have the correct branch before initiating any NEFT, RTGS, or IMPS transfer.

IFSC vs MICR — Functional Comparison

Two different codes, two different banking systems

FeatureIFSC CodeMICR Code
Full FormIndian Financial System CodeMagnetic Ink Character Recognition
Length & Format11 characters — alphanumeric9 digits — numeric only
This BranchHUSB0000003415866101
Primary UseElectronic fund transfers: NEFT, RTGS, IMPS, UPIPhysical cheque clearing at clearing houses
MediumDigital / online — no physical document neededPrinted in magnetic ink on cheque leaf bottom band
Processing SpeedReal-time (IMPS/UPI) or 30-min batches (NEFT)T+1 or T+2 clearing cycle via RBI clearing houses
Where to Find ItCheque leaf (top area), passbook first page, net bankingBottom band of cheque leaf (the printed magnetic strip)
Assigned ByRBI — permanent unless branch is relocated/mergedRBI — encodes city (3) + bank (3) + branch (3) digits
Required ForAdding a payee / beneficiary for online transferCheque book issuance and clearing house processing

Source: Reserve Bank of India (RBI) Payment Systems Guidelines. IFSC mandatory for NEFT/RTGS/IMPS since 2010; MICR used by CTS-2010 standard cheque clearing.
